Chennai : Anna University is all set to get a state-of-the-art Digital Knowledge Centre, thanks to the efforts undertaken by the Class of 1979 of the College of Engineering, Guindy. The centre, which will be set up with the help of contributions made by the alumni, will be inaugurated on Tuesday by Vice Chancellor, D. Viswanathan. Spread over 2,000 square feet, the Rs. 70-lakh centre will have a browsing section and a content section. The alumni contribution alone is Rs 25 lakh.
Access to libraries
The new centre is expected to help researchers, students and faculty keep abreast of the latest developments by facilitating access to free/subscription digital libraries around the world. The university will also be able to upload its own research on to its servers, thus enabling access by peer researchers around the world. All funding is by individual members alone.
Record time
The infrastructure was set up in a record time of 30 days. The university also proposes to set up a trust to facilitate more such contributions in the future.
